QUETTA:

Leaders of the Balochistan National Party (BNP) have blamed the incumbent government for the Machh attack because they couldn’t protect the people.

“The government is completely paralyzed and has completely failed to protect the lives and property of the people,” they said. “All people have equal rights in Balochistan. The Minister is concerned about the road but does not care about the precious human lives.”

These views were expressed by Senior Vice President of Balochistan National Party Malik Abdul Wali Kakar, Nasir Ali Shah, Members of Assembly Akhtar Hussain Langau, Ahmad Nawaz Baloch, Musa Baloch, Ghulam Nabi Murree, Javed Baloch, Dr Ali Ahmad Qambrani, Mir Ghulam Rasool Mengal, Naseem Javed Hazara and others while addressing a protest in front of the Quetta Press Club against the killing of Hazara miners in Machh.
